SET channels

SET currently offers four subsidiary channels:
  • SET International
    SET International
    SET International is a satellite cable channel operated by Sanlih E-Television in Taiwan, launched on March 2000, but only broadcasts abroad.-External links:...

     (began airing March 2000)
  • SET Taiwan
    SET Taiwan
    SET Taiwan is a television channel of the Sanlih E-Television in Taiwan, launched in September 1993. It mainly broadcasts Taiwanese drama.-External links:...

     (began airing December 1996)
  • SET News
    SET News
    SET News is a 24 hour news channel of the Sanlih E-Television in Taiwan, launched in March 1998-Typical schedule:-External links:...

     (began airing March 1998)
  • SET Metro
    SET Metro
    SET Metro is a television channel of the Sanlih E-Television in Taiwan, launched in September 1995. It mainly broadcasts Taiwanese drama and cartoons.-External links:...

     (began airing September 1995)
